View Top Employees for Wwf Colombia
img Website wwf.org.co
img Industry Environmental Services
img Location Colombia
img Employees 112
img Website wwf.org.co
img Industry Environmental Services
img Location Colombia
img Employees 112
img LinkedIn linkedin.com/company/wwf---colombia

Top Wwf Colombia Employees